From 0c1009608722635a26ee0924b4cf5b5f3e8476c2 Mon Sep 17 00:00:00 2001 From: Miikka Heikkinen Date: Fri, 26 Apr 2024 16:00:07 +0300 Subject: [PATCH] QmlDesigner: Restore auxiliary properties after rewriter model attach Successfully restoring auxiliary properties requires scene model to be complete, so we must wait until model is attached. Fixes: QDS-12615 Change-Id: I906e9b50df14fcdbc0cad8370c5466db5c1aab02 Reviewed-by: Thomas Hartmann (cherry picked from commit 7ba7624bb6c778498f66963c4a210458a66d1df8) --- src/plugins/qmldesigner/designercore/model/rewriterview.cpp | 1 + 1 file changed, 1 insertion(+) diff --git a/src/plugins/qmldesigner/designercore/model/rewriterview.cpp b/src/plugins/qmldesigner/designercore/model/rewriterview.cpp index 17d40daca3e..d8812a76d06 100644 --- a/src/plugins/qmldesigner/designercore/model/rewriterview.cpp +++ b/src/plugins/qmldesigner/designercore/model/rewriterview.cpp @@ -104,6 +104,7 @@ void RewriterView::modelAttached(Model *model) m_modelAttachPending = true; QTimer::singleShot(1000, this, [this, model](){ modelAttached(model); + restoreAuxiliaryData(); }); } }